    Key insights:
    💡 Stand out by being yourself and doing what you like to do and what you want to do, and they'll naturally attract you.
    😕 If she texts you first or gives you more in the conversation, she likes you, but if she's very dry and ghosts you, obviously she doesn't really like you.
    👀 Actions speak louder than words, so watch what people do and not what they say.
    🏋‍♂ Go to places that are interesting to you, like a gym or a coffee shop, to meet people who share your interests and values.
    💕 Vulnerability can deepen a connection, but it's important to approach it in a way that shows emotional control and strength.
    🌱 Putting effort into yourself and your life is the baseline for attracting the right people.
    🚩 It depends on the girl and her own experiences, everyone has different versions of what red flags are.
    TLDR: Being authentic, pursuing your interests, and putting effort into yourself is the best way to attract the right people into your life.
    1. 00:00 🔍 Women give subtle cues like smiling and being more outgoing when they like someone, and it's important to pay attention to these hints.
    1.1 Women are open to giving guys who aren't their type a chance, and standing out involves being open-minded and not being narrow in what they're looking for.
    1.2 Be yourself and do what you like, and you will naturally attract people who like you for who you are.
    1.3 Women give subtle cues like smiling and being more outgoing when they like someone, and it's important to pay attention to these hints.
    1.4 If a girl acts nervous around you, gives you attention, and texts you first, she probably likes you, but if she's dry in conversation and ghosts you, she doesn't like you.
    2. 03:17 👍 Labeling people as alpha or beta is cringe and immature, and if you have to tell people that you are something, you just aren't.
    2.1 The speaker and the mature women agree that labelling people as alpha or beta is cringe and they don't take it seriously.
    2.2 If you have to tell people that you are something, you just aren't, and going around calling people "beta males" is immature and embarrassing.
    3. 05:17 🔍 Pay attention to actions, not just words, and avoid the cycle of breaking up and getting back together with an ex, especially if there was cheating.
    3.1 Breaking up and getting back together with an ex is not a good idea, especially if there is cheating involved, as it often leads to a continuous cycle of breaking up and getting back together.
    3.2 Actions speak louder than words, so pay attention to what someone does rather than what they say, and don't talk yourself out of it just because you want something.
    4. 07:21 🔍 Rekindling a relationship after a breakup can work out, introverted guys should push themselves out of their comfort zone to meet people and date, rejection is tough but joining groups can help.
    4.1 Rekindling a relationship after a breakup can work out, especially if both parties have matured.
    4.2 Introverted guys who don't have a thriving social life should force themselves to get out of their comfort zone in order to meet people and date.
    4.3 Push yourself out of your comfort zone by doing one small thing every day, go to places that interest you, and join a community or group where you can naturally meet people with similar interests.
    4.4 Rejection is tough, but joining groups can help, and lack of experience may not be a major issue in dating.
    5. 10:41 🔍 Guys should be honest about their lack of dating experience, and true vulnerability in a relationship is about being able to talk about emotions and trusting someone with past experiences and fears.
    5.1 It's okay to be honest about your lack of dating experience if it comes up naturally in conversation, but there's no need to announce it.
    5.2 Guys often feel like they can't express their emotions in a relationship because they think women get turned off by vulnerability, but in reality, they may not be truly vulnerable.
    5.3 True vulnerability is not about emotional instability or dumping traumas on someone, but rather about being able to talk about emotions and trusting someone with past experiences and fears.
    6. 12:56 🔍 Sharing controlled vulnerability and opening up confidently can deepen connections and progress relationships, while emotional instability is unattractive to women.
    6.1 Check out the video for a better explanation, as it's difficult to articulate, but the main point is that showing emotion doesn't necessarily mean crying or being angry.
    6.2 Sharing vulnerability and opening up in a controlled and confident manner can deepen connections and progress relationships, while lack of control and emotional instability are unattractive to women.
    7. 14:15 👫 Focus on an abundance mindset, be present, work on confidence, lower expectations, and redefine success to feel more confident and less rejected in dating interactions.
    7.1 The speaker gives advice to an outgoing person who has trouble dating and suggests that insecurity may be the issue.
    7.2 Focus on having a mindset of abundance rather than scarcity when approaching women, and try to be present at the moment rather than worrying about potential rejection.
    7.3 Invest in yourself and work on your own confidence and well-being in order to naturally attract the kind of people you want in your life.
    7.4 Lower your expectations, focus on small steps, and change your definition of success to feel more confident and less rejected in dating interactions.
    8. 17:18 🔍 Open communication and aligned values are key in a relationship, don't worry about lack of sexual experience.
    8.1 The speaker discusses concerns about lack of sexual experience and whether it would be a red flag for a girl he likes but ultimately concludes that it depends on the individual and their perspective.
    8.2 Experience does not always mean better, open communication and learning about each other is more important in a relationship.
    8.3 Open communication and asking about her likes are important, finding someone with aligned values is key, and don't worry too much about inexperience.
